(a) Why is small intestine in herbivores longer than in carnivores ?

(b) What will happen if mucus is not secreted by the gastric glands ?

(c) What causes movement of food inside the alimentary canal ?

(a) Herbivores eat only plants so they need a longer small intestine to allow the cellulose present in the plants to be digested completely. 

(b) If mucus is not secreted, hydrochloric acid will cause the erosion of inner lining of stomach leading to the formation of ulcers in the stomach. 

(c) The contraction and expansion movements of oesophagus also called peristaltic movements pushes the food down into the elementary canal.
